NettetMathematically, regression uses a linear function to approximate (predict) the dependent variable given as: Y = βo + β1X + ∈ where, Y - Dependent variable X - Independent variable βo - Intercept β1 - Slope ∈ - Error βo and β1 are known as coefficients. This is the equation of simple linear regression.
